Net Neutrality
One last step Through the forest before the trees are cut down. One last flight into space Before the the satellites keep us in. One last read Before the library cuts the sentence by toll. One last champion Before his logos show. One last man. Before he places the devil around his neck. One last word. Before they charge me for every other after. Freedom doesn't have "a last". Freedom is lasting.
Vote for net neutrality. You deserve to know. You deserve to not be charged to know. Be free. Our one last freedom is this tiny screen in your hand right now.
